It replaces two separate gears and an idler shaft in many designs.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/div\u003e\n    \u003c\/details\u003e\n\n    \u003cdetails\u003e\n      \u003csummary\u003eAre these compatible with plastic pinion gears?\u003c\/summary\u003e\n      \u003cdiv class=\"hdiy-faq-body\"\u003e\u003cp\u003eYes, as long as the mating pinion is also Mod 0.5. Metal-to-plastic gear pairing is common in RC and toy applications; the softer plastic pinion typically acts as the sacrificial wear component, protecting the motor shaft. Ensure the plastic pinion's bore and tooth profile match before meshing. Avoid excessive preload, which accelerates wear on the plastic gear.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/div\u003e\n    \u003c\/details\u003e\n\n    \u003cdetails\u003e\n      \u003csummary\u003eWhich pack size should I order?\u003c\/summary\u003e\n      \u003cdiv class=\"hdiy-faq-body\"\u003e\u003cp\u003eFor a single repair or replacement, Pack of 1 or 2 is sufficient. Compare the per-unit price across pack sizes shown on the product page to find the best fit for your volume.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/div\u003e\n    \u003c\/details\u003e\n\n    \u003cdetails\u003e\n      \u003csummary\u003eHow do I measure my existing gear to confirm compatibility?\u003c\/summary\u003e\n      \u003cdiv class=\"hdiy-faq-body\"\u003e\u003cp\u003eUse a digital caliper to measure: (1) bore diameter — the hole through the center; (2) outer diameter (OD) — tip to tip across the gear; (3) tooth count — count all teeth around the gear. For a Mod 0.5 gear, OD ≈ (tooth count + 2) × 0.5 mm. If your measured OD matches this formula, the gear is Mod 0.5 and compatible with these gears.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/div\u003e\n    \u003c\/details\u003e\n\n  \u003c\/div\u003e\n\n  \u003cdiv class=\"hdiy-cta\"\u003e\n    🛒 Select your Spur Gear Size and QTY above, then add to cart.\n  \u003c\/div\u003e\n\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\n\u003cscript type=\"application\/ld+json\"\u003e\n{\n  \"@context\": \"https:\/\/schema.org\",\n  \"@type\": \"FAQPage\",\n  \"mainEntity\": [\n    {\n      \"@type\": \"Question\",\n      \"name\": \"How do I choose the right size code for my RC car or boat?\",\n      \"acceptedAnswer\": {\n        \"@type\": \"Answer\",\n        \"text\": \"Match the bore diameter to your motor or shaft diameter first: 1012A(1.9) fits ~1.9 mm shafts, 1012(2.3) fits ~2.3 mm, 1015(2.9) fits ~2.9 mm, and 1014(3.175) fits ~3.175 mm (1\/8 in) shafts.
